A Conspiracy of Witches

319 pages2022 4 editions

fiction fantasy romance adventurous medium-paced

396 pages 1 edition

fiction fantasy romance adventurous emotional mysterious medium-paced

455 pages2023 1 edition

fiction fantasy romance adventurous emotional fast-paced